Address 5434.13 tPPC

n3zwcmrpKu96vfuBCxpcyVJYzwMsSu4BXy

Confirmed

Total Received5434.13 tPPC
Total Sent0 tPPC
Final Balance5434.13 tPPC
No. Transactions1

Transactions

No Inputs (Newly Generated Coins)
n3zwcmrpKu96vfuBCxpcyVJYzwMsSu4BXy5434.13 tPPC ×
Fee: 0 tPPC
465362 Confirmations5434.13 tPPC